The Art of Kindness
In the bustling city of Metropolitan in Finland, where everyone seemed to be in a perpetual hurry, there was a small, cozy café named "The Heart's Haven." It wasn't just any café; it was a sanctuary of warmth and kindness, lovingly run by an artist named Elena. Her vision was to create a space where people could find solace and inspiration, a place where kindness flowed as freely as the aroma of freshly brewed coffee.
Elena was a talented painter, but her true masterpiece was the community she built through her café. She believed that art had the power to touch hearts and transform lives, and she used her creativity to spread kindness in the most unexpected ways. Every wall in the café was adorned with her vibrant paintings, each telling a story of compassion, hope, and love.
Part 1: The Essence of Heart's Haven
One rainy afternoon, a young woman named Sophie walked into The Heart's Haven. She was drenched, not just from the rain, but from the weight of the world on her shoulders. She had recently lost her job and was struggling to find her footing. Elena noticed Sophie’s forlorn expression and approached her with a warm smile.
"Welcome to The Heart's Haven," Elena said gently. "Can I get you something warm to drink?"
Sophie nodded, her eyes welling up with tears. "A cup of coffee would be nice," she whispered.
As Sophie sipped her coffee, she couldn't help but admire the artwork around her. One painting, in particular, caught her eye—a depiction of a sunflower standing tall amidst a storm. It resonated deeply with her, symbolizing resilience and hope in the face of adversity.
Elena noticed Sophie’s interest and sat down beside her. "That painting is called 'Strength in the Storm.' I painted it during a challenging time in my life. It's a reminder that even in the darkest moments, we can find strength and grow."
Sophie felt a glimmer of hope. She shared her struggles with Elena, who listened with empathy and kindness. Elena then had an idea. She invited Sophie to participate in the café's community art project, where patrons could contribute their own pieces to create a mosaic of kindness.
Part 2: The Community Mosaic
Sophie hesitated at first, doubting her artistic abilities. But Elena encouraged her, explaining that the project was not about perfection but about expressing oneself and spreading positivity. Sophie decided to give it a try. She painted a small canvas with vibrant colours and added it to the mosaic. The act of creating something beautiful brought her a sense of fulfilment and joy that she hadn't felt in a long time.
Word of The Heart's Haven's kindness and creativity spread throughout the city. People from all walks of life began visiting the café, each contributing their own piece of art and sharing their stories. The mosaic grew, becoming a magnificent tapestry of human experience and emotion. It was a testament to the power of kindness and the creativity that dwells within everyone.
As the mosaic expanded, so did the community's spirit of giving. Patrons started organizing charity events, art workshops for children, and outreach programs for the less fortunate. The café became a beacon of hope, showing that even small acts of kindness could create ripples of positive change.
Part 3: Kindness in Action
Sophie found a new job and regained her confidence, but she never forgot the kindness she experienced at The Heart's Haven. She continued to visit the café, not just as a patron but as a volunteer, helping others who were in need of a little kindness and creativity in their lives.
Elena's dream of creating a haven for the heart had come true. The café wasn't just a place to enjoy coffee and art; it was a living, breathing testament to the beauty of kindness and creativity intertwined. And as the community mosaic continued to grow, so did the bonds between the people of Metropolitan united by the art of kindness.
Part 4: The Ripple Effect
Elena started noticing the impact of the café on the community. One of the regular patrons, an elderly man named Mr. Thompson, began sharing stories of his youth during his visits. He mentioned how the café had given him a renewed sense of purpose and a place to connect with others. Inspired by his words, Elena organized a weekly storytelling night, where people could come together to share their experiences and learn from one another.
This weekly event became a cornerstone of The Heart's Haven, drawing in crowds of all ages. The stories shared ranged from humorous anecdotes to poignant tales of triumph and loss. It became a place where people could find empathy and support, fostering a deeper sense of community.
Part 5: Creativity as a Healer
Elena also introduced art therapy sessions for those who were dealing with personal struggles. She believed that creativity had the power to heal and wanted to provide a space for individuals to express their emotions through art. These sessions became immensely popular, helping people cope with stress, anxiety, and grief.
Sophie, who had found solace in the café during her darkest days, decided to train as an art therapist. She wanted to give back and help others the way Elena had helped her. With Elena's guidance, Sophie completed her training and started leading some of the therapy sessions. It was a full-circle moment for her, transforming her own pain into a source of healing for others.
Part 6: Expanding the Vision
Elena's vision for The Heart's Haven continued to expand. She partnered with local schools to bring art and kindness programs to students. These programs encouraged children to express themselves creatively and to practice acts of kindness in their daily lives. The impact was profound, as teachers reported improvements in student behaviour, increased empathy, and a stronger sense of community within the schools.
The café also began hosting annual art festivals, showcasing the works of local artists and raising funds for various charitable causes. These festivals became a celebration of creativity and kindness, drawing visitors from near and far. The sense of unity and purpose that permeated the events was a testament to the power of Elena's vision.
Conclusion: The Legacy of The Heart's Haven
In the end, The Heart's Haven became much more than a café. It was a symbol of what could be achieved when kindness and creativity were woven into the fabric of a community. Elena's belief in the transformative power of art and compassion had created a ripple effect, touching countless lives.
Sophie, now a successful art therapist, often reflected on her journey and the pivotal role The Heart's Haven had played in her life. She knew that the café would always be a place where people could find hope, healing, and a sense of belonging.
Elena's dream had come to life in ways she had never imagined. The Heart's Haven stood as a beacon of light in Metropolitan, reminding everyone who walked through its doors that kindness and creativity could change the world, one small act at a time.
